What happens to the temperature as we go higher in the troposphere?
AIncreases
BDecreases
CRemains constant
DFirst increases then decreases
✓ Correct Answer: B — Decreases
In the troposphere, the temperature generally decreases by about 6.5 degrees Celsius for every kilometer of altitude.
